A Non-Invasive Tool for Real-Time Measurement of Sulfate in Living Cells
Sulfur (S) is an essential element for all forms of life. It is involved in numerous essential processes because S is considered as the primary source of one of the essential amino acids, methionine, which plays an important role in biological events.
